Higher-Order Structure (HOS) Characterization
Monitor subtle tertiary and quaternary structural changes using highly sensitive near-UV CD. Chirascan detects shifts in aromatic environments, disulfide bond geometry, and conformational microheterogeneity.
Measure Protein Stability
Track the loss of secondary or tertiary structure as temperature increases to uncover thermal resilience. Determine key stability metrics like Melting temperature (Tm), Enthalpy of unfolding (ΔHvH), Onset temperature (Tonset), and Thermal reversibility
